The pharmaceutical industry is on the cusp of a revolution, thanks to the advent of generative artificial intelligence (AI) technology. This innovative approach is transforming the traditional drug development process, which has long been plagued by high costs, lengthy timelines, and low success rates. With AI, scientists can digitally design drug molecules, which are then physically created and tested for their interaction with target proteins. The results are fed back into the AI software, accelerating the development process. While AI-developed drugs are already in clinical trials, experts acknowledge that there is still much to be learned. The technology holds great promise, however, with the potential to significantly reduce the time and cost associated with traditional drug development, which can take up to 15 years and cost an average of $1 billion.
